The H-1B landscape in 2026 continues to be shaped by lottery dynamics and evolving USCIS processing. For Machine Learning Engineers in Virginia, understanding the FY2027 lottery's overall 35.3% selection odds is key. While large companies like Amazon and Microsoft filed tens of thousands of petitions, indicating strong demand, the new Form I-129, mandatory since April 2026, aims to streamline processes but also introduces new compliance requirements.
Concerns about the $100K fee, which applies only to consular processing, remain a point of confusion, though F-1 OPT Change of Status applications are exempt. Additionally, the expanded social media vetting, effective March 30, 2026, means applicants should be prepared for increased scrutiny. PWD processing times averaging 3-4 months are relatively stable, but applicants should factor this into their overall timeline.
